Today Governor Josh Stein announced that the State of North Carolina is offering a reward of up to $25,000 for information leading to the arrest and conviction of the person or persons responsible for the murder of A’yanna Allen, age 7, and attempted murder of Shirley Robinson, age 56.
“We must use every tool at our disposal to pursue justice for victims,” said Governor Josh Stein. “I urge North Carolinians who have information about this case to contact local law enforcement and help us hold A’yanna Allen’s murderer accountable."
On December 4, 2016, officers responded to a residence on Harrel Street in Salisbury following a report of a shooting. Officers found two people shot inside the home. The 7-year-old victim, A’yanna Allen, died from her injuries. The second victim, Shirley Robinson, sustained a gunshot wound but survived.
